If your plugin reads temperature or humidity from the Verdantry greenhouse controller, be aware that sensor drift accumulates after roughly 30 days without recalibration. Symptoms include a slow upward bias of 0.2–0.5 degrees and humidity readings that plateau near the top of range. Before filing a defect against the core firmware, trigger the self-calibration routine and wait two full cycles. If drift persists, capture the controller state and note the firmware trace token shown immediately below.

session token of tajef-bageg = htk21_5d90d574934f3ccae6437

## Deploying the Gatewick Proctor Queue

Deploys are pretty painless: push to main, wait for the pipeline, then watch the queue drain dashboard for five minutes. If candidates pile up mid-exam, roll back first and ask questions later — the queue replays safely. Everything the workers care about lives in one config block, shown here for reference.

settings of bafof-yagef:
JOROX_PIN=8740
JOROX_TENANT=pelox
JOROX_METRICS_HOST=metrics.jorox.qorvelworks.internal
JOROX_SEAL=seal_c78f63c1
JOROX_STANDBY_TEAM=norax

## Limits & Quotas

Hey reviewer — SproutMinder caps watering jobs per zone so a misconfigured greenhouse can't flood the queue. Quotas reset at local midnight, and overflow jobs get deferred, not dropped. Don't bump these without pinging the firmware folks; the valves genuinely can't keep up. Here are the current caps, straight from the config.

constants for tageg-kagag:
QUOTAS = {
    "kelax": 495,
    "istath": 366,
    "tammir": 108,
    "novdor": 730,
    "casax": 816,
    "quenael": 874,
    "pelius": 403,
}

**Prototype Workshop — Access**

The workshop on Level B of the Corvane Annex is restricted to cleared staff. Team assistants may enter to drop off parts or paperwork between 09:00 and 16:30. Safety glasses are on the rack inside the door; wear them even for short visits. Book bench time through Marisol on the fabrication team. The keypad code for the workshop door is below.

door code, kawip-bagap: bdg-HQEWH-4